Abstract:

本发明提供了基于扩散模型和多类特征的火焰燃烧状态识别方法及系统,通过利用去噪扩散概率模型生成虚拟火焰图像,所述去噪扩散概率模型包括正向扩散过程、逆向扩散过程和生成过程,所述逆向扩散过程通过Unet网络和反向传播算法实现;利用所述虚拟火焰图像扩充真实图像,得到建模图像,利用LeNet‑5模型提取所述建模图像的深度特征和物理特征,再将所述深度特征和所述物理特征融合,得到融合特征;利用所述融合特征构建基于深度森林分类的火焰状态识别模型,以实现火焰燃烧状态识别。本发明能够克服建模样本数量不足和特征表征不充分的难点,提高火焰燃烧状态识别的准确率。
